Method
How to make a Russian Cocaine
-
- Pour vodka into a shot glass
-
- Sprinkle some sugar and ground coffee beans onto the slice of lemon and serve alongside the shot
-
- Eat the lemon slice just before downing the shot

FAQ's
How do I properly prepare a Russian Cocaine cocktail?
To prepare a Russian Cocaine cocktail, start by chilling a shot glass. Pour 30ml of vodka into the shot glass. Take a slice of lemon and dip one side in sugar and the other side in coffee grounds. Bite the lemon slice and then drink the shot of vodka. This cocktail is not shaken or stirred, keeping the preparation simple and straightforward.
